My name is Rebecca and I have 3 boys, Keller (5), Daniel (2) and my littlest Nathan (Nay-nay) is 8 mos. He was diagnosed with reflux in the hospital as he started gagging and choking. They did a barium swallow, upper GI xray. you could see it plainly on the xray the barium coming back up.
Saying that, I think Nay-nay is certainly one of the milder cases. He was put on prevacid 15mg right away and has been on that since birth (minus a week when another Dr in my Drs practice took him off it and put him on Zantac).
Since he has been exposed to more foods his screaming, finger thrusting, drooling, waking at night, back arching, neck flexing has all gotten worse. So I am here to learn what I can do to help him. He is such a sweet happy baby, even when he is hurting. He will scream and when I look at him (to pick him up) he gives me a sweet smile as if to say, "I'm not mad at you momma, I'm just hurting." :cry:
He has had chronic ear infections and has tubes in his ears (he got those at 6 mos). I just learned that could also be a sign of reflux.
